Re: dominator 2600 bags

Just a bump...

I got done putting the drivers side together. However, there is 1 little part that needs to be trimmed on the pocket, towards the front.

BUT, by looking at the pics up above, and me trying on the blazer....I can tell you, my shit is hitting the spindle. Literally, with 100psi in the bag, the bag balloons and touches the spindle.

Not too sure how else to try to get these to work, other than throw the D2500's I have in.

Re: dominator 2600 bags

I just put some on a 1st gen, they are no where near touching the spindle. Too much cutting for me tho, the D2500s ride good and max the suspension out, no reason to run D2600s IMO.
